    It was already stated around Anfield that Hamill had the talent before he went out on loan. The problem was that when ever he played he was always playing for himself. It wasn't that he was a ******, it was just that he was always trying to do some magic to impress the on watching gaffers.

    Hamill was told this before he went out on loan and he has been at pains to say this year that this is the main thing he has learned, to play for the team and not for himself. I see the pars manager has also said he has noticed a difference in attitude.

    There is no doubt that had Hamill been at the level he is now last year he would have got a chance. But with Leto coming in, Kewell reluctant to leave and this new superstar coming in I would say it looks likely he will be sent on loan.

    And for those who haven't seen Hamill play this year he has been nothing short of sensational according to the manager, players and fans of the club. I'm sure those who were interested will have seen the same things!
